Top SaaS in Nagpur, India

List of top verified SaaS in Nagpur, India, near me. Last updated Jan 2025

We found 1 directory listings in Nagpur

Lockene

Address: Plot no 74 deshpande layout, Nagpur, Maharashtra 440008, India
+91 8668546474
2020 Established
E-mail
Map
Website
1 Photos

Filter by City

Related Categories